"Childhood Apraxia of Speech (CAS) is a motor speech disorder that first becomes apparent as a young child is learning speech. Children with apraxia of speech have great difficulty planning and producing the precise, highly refined and specific series of movements of the oral muscles that are necessary for intelligible speech." In general, not much is known about the disorder. The goal of the 2013 Capital Region Walk for Children with Apraxia of Speech is to educate the public, professionals, and parents, as well as to assist with fundraising to continue research as well as developing a support network for others affected by apraxia.
